  • is anyone working on an realistic storytelling AI?
    I think the biggest trouble is remembering context, so you either play something where context is short and changes frequently (Agon?), or need some way to add an explicit "memory". I know novel AI has a "lorebook" function where you can explicit certain worldbuilding elements, but I've never used it so I can't attest to its quality. Source: about 1 year ago

  • Smarter or not?
    Bots forget chat history over time due to memory limitations. All chat bots have limited memory, but some have more limited memory than others. It's dependent on the website host. Look at NovelAI's pricing as an example; its highest memory is 2048 Tokens (~8192 characters). Source: about 1 year ago
